Default Seat cooling stopped working

My seat cooling stopped working properly this week. When I push the button, the little LEDs light up for about 1second, and then turn off. Both driver and passenger buttons do the same thing.

any thoughts about what it could be? Heating still works properly.

Old school: check fuse?

bingo - you win! I washed the car today and had the same thought. Had to dig out the manual to find them... and sure enough it was the fuse. I don't have any extra fuses so I need to go pick some up and hope that they don't blow again.
